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for 2018 was CNY 2,566,307,319.11, representing a year-on-year increase of 10.99% compared to CNY 2,312,138,516.90 in 2017[21]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ders of the listed company was CNY 199,350,471.51, a decrease of 3.90% from CNY 207,440,928.08 in the previous year[21]. - The net profit after deducting non-recurring gains and losses was CNY 202,913,028.64, showing a slight decrease of 0.49% compared to CNY 203,910,274.89 in 2017[21]. - Basic earnings per share decreased by 13.56% to CNY 0.51 in 2018 compared to CNY 0.59 in 2017[22]. - Diluted earnings per share also fell by 13.56% to CNY 0.51 in 2018 from CNY 0.59 in 2017[22]. - The weighted average return on equity dropped to 8.78% in 2018 from 12.82% in 2017, a decrease of 4.04 percentage points[22]. - The cash flow from operating activities was negative at CNY -63,616,492.28, compared to a positive cash flow of CNY 168,988,315.67 in 2017[21]. - The company's total assets at the end of 2018 were CNY 3,038,579,906.69, an increase of 13.07% from CNY 2,687,301,661.59 at the end of 2017[21]. - The company's total equity attributable to shareholders increased by 5.29% to CNY 2,344,080,520.41 at the end of 2018 from CNY 2,226,233,927.34 at the end of 2017[21]. Dividend and Profit Distribution - The company plans to distribute a cash dividend of CNY 3.00 per 10 shares, totaling CNY 118,095,320.40, and to increase capital by converting reserves, resulting in a total share capital of 511,746,388 shares[5]. - The profit distribution plan is subject to approval at the shareholders' meeting, indicating a focus on shareholder returns[5]. - In 2018, the company distributed a cash dividend of 3.00 RMB per 10 shares, amounting to a total of 118,095,320.40 RMB, which represents 59.24% of the net profit attributable to ordinary shareholders[109]. - The profit distribution policy requires prior consultation with independent directors and approval from more than half of the board before any changes can be made[108]. - The company has committed to not engaging in competitive activities that may harm its business interests and will take necessary steps to exit any such competition[110]. Operational and Market Strategy - The company primarily engages in the research, production, and sales of fine wool yarns, focusing on high-end brands[31]. - The company has established a stable customer base with over 3,000 clients globally and more than 400 apparel brand partners, earning various awards such as "Gold Supplier" and "Best Service Award"[38]. - The company is recognized as a "Manufacturing Single Champion Demonstration Enterprise" by the Ministry of Industry and Information Technology of China, highlighting its competitive edge in the wool spinning industry[38]. - The company is actively involved in product innovation, focusing on differentiated, functional, and high-value-added products, particularly in the sports fashion segment[36]. - The company has a strong supply chain management strategy, ensuring the continuity of wool supply during peak seasons to meet market demands[40]. Research and Development - Research and development expenses increased by 13.10% to ¥72,213,559.75 from ¥63,850,946.85[53]. - Total R&D investment amounted to ¥72,213,559.75, representing 2.81% of operating revenue, with 300 R&D personnel making up 11.66% of the total workforce[66]. - The company has introduced advanced spinning equipment from Germany and Italy, significantly improving its production technology and efficiency[39]. Environmental and Social Responsibility - The company has established a charitable fund for students, contributing to local education and community support initiatives[142]. - The company has actively participated in community service activities, including infrastructure development and disaster relief efforts[142]. - The company has committed to promoting ecological sustainability and social responsibility within the textile sector[89]. - The company has received the ISO 14000 environmental management system certification and has not faced any penalties for violations of environmental protection laws during the reporting period[157]. Shareholder Structure and Governance - The total number of ordinary shares after the recent changes is 393,651,068, with 70,593,068 shares being released from restrictions[162]. - The largest shareholder, Zhejiang Xin'ao Industrial Co., Ltd., holds 122,400,000 shares, representing 31.09% of total shares[172]. - The company has maintained a consistent leadership structure, with key executives serving in their roles since 2007, ensuring stability[184]. - The board of directors consists of 9 members, including 1 chairman, 1 vice chairman, and 3 independent directors, and held 8 meetings during the reporting period[194].
